Output 94666284c65e0d87ddc1de1b2f4411135e9881342d088a86ce2dfe20059b0fe2:0

value
243298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f711512013f5e819a5ebb7d33b8906f47d3d9aae OP_EQUAL
address
3QDPa8CLPt8hLNT4A39YooR5dFxLDv9bvT
transaction
94666284c65e0d87ddc1de1b2f4411135e9881342d088a86ce2dfe20059b0fe2
spent
true